Table of Contents
Uppdaterad
Nyligen fick en liten del av våra användare ett felmeddelande som kommer att dev / tty.debug blockeras. Detta problem kan möjligen uppstå av flera anledningar. Låt oss titta på dessa typer av nu.
Uppdaterad
Är du trött på att din dator går långsamt? Irriterad av frustrerande felmeddelanden? ASR Pro är lösningen för dig! Vårt rekommenderade verktyg kommer snabbt att diagnostisera och reparera Windows-problem samtidigt som systemets prestanda ökar dramatiskt. Så vänta inte längre, ladda ner ASR Pro idag!
Ibland, om Linux-anslutningen, som alltid ansluts via Minicom, nästan säkert går förlorad, kan ett fel uppstå nästa gång du startar Minicom:
/dev ttyS0-enheten är låst.
Aliaset – dev / ttyS0 kan skilja sig beroende på din COM-port.
För att undvika ett sådant häpnadsväckande fel måste du fylla i Minicom korrekt och skapa användning av CTRL-A-nycklarna följt av Q-signifikanten.
Du kan vanligtvis åtgärda problemet genom att ta bort som den nya rootanvändaren med dig ser, kommandot:
killall -9 minicom
sudo killall -9 minicom
Eller så kan du helt enkelt ta bort filen “LCK..ttyS0” i / var kontra lock / katalogen. Om
Ibland blir du av med överflödig anslutning till en enhet via minicom, nästa schema startar du en minicom kan du se ett helt fantastiskt fel:
/dev ttyS0-enheten är låst.
Namnet dev / ttyS0 kan skilja sig beroende på COM-porten. För att undvika detta, stäng alltid av Minicom i omedelbar närhet med CTRL + A-tangenterna följt av Q-tangenterna. Rätt
Finns det en strategi för att aktivera USB-felsökning på låst Android?
Ok, tillräckligt om USB-felsökningsläge, tillbaka till ämnesmaterialet, här är var och en av våra effektiva lösningar som du kan följa för att positivt aktivera USB-felsökning på en låst Android – oavsett om du skapar ett delat låslösenord, PIN-kod eller vilken specifik sak annars, gör det inte. känner till eller minns utan tvekan mönstret, eller kanske av någon annan anledning är din faktiska Android-enhet låst eller otillgänglig.
Att, till exempel en Cheer-användare, kan dina behov avsluta vår process. Först behövde jag dricka en rejäl kopp latinamerikanskt kaffe. Använd kommandona strax efter för din terminal:
killall -9 minicom
Likaså i Ubuntu. Kör ditt kommando i en betrodd terminal med sudo:
sudo killall -9 minicom
LCK..ttyS0 på / var / lock-webbplatsen.
Det var för mina ögon! Jag hoppas att den lilla handledningen var till hjälp för dig. Om du måste vill lära dig mer om nätverksbyggandet, läs detta CompTIA-certifieringsnätverket + All-in-roman – En guide till tentamen, 7:e formen (examen N10-007)
/ Dev versus Console
Varför låstes enheten/dev/ttyusb0?
Enheten och dev/ttyUSB0 måste vara låsta. När du kontrollerade listan över processer via Playstation, visades korrekt körande gtkterm-process. Jag fixade den här typen av genom att helt enkelt ta bort /run/lock/LCK..ttyUSB0. Efter det har gtkterm utvecklats för att framgångsrikt öppna ttyUSB0.
På Linux kan alla kärnkonsoler anpassas ytterligare med ett särskilt startalternativ för console =
. Kärnan som anropar printk ()
kan skicka textmeddelanden till den, till exempel när en nedladdning och installation av programvara eller ett fel inträffar. Dessa meddelanden är utöver det som ofta buffras av kärnan. (Se ytterligare dmesg
). När konsolenheten används och startas kommer den att ta emot alla tidigare buffrade meddelanden.
Du kan skicka konsolen är lika med
flera gånger till valfritt antal designkonsoler, och meddelanden kommer att skrivas till var och en. Självklart kan du bara välja en playstation av varje “typ”: du kan inte använda spelkonsoler = ttyS0 samtidigt
tillsammans med console = ttyS1
.
I vår egen kärndokumentation hänvisas / dev / gaming console
till som en specialteknologi för tecken numrerad (5,1)
. Detta preliminära utkast gör susen öppnar “huvudkonsolen”, som är den ultimata terminalen i konsolens inköpslista. Det verkligen första icke-kärnprojektet som heter init
eller helt enkelt “PID 1” skapas med / dev console
, som är länkat till stdout, premier error och stdin …
Om det utan tvivel inte finns några problem med någon konsol, kör eller dev / console
nedladdningen ENODEV
(“Inte den här enhetstypen”). dessa kärnor kommer att skriva ut och fortfarande hantera init
. För ett exempel på kärnan för en fantastisk icke-TTY-konsol, se netconsole
eller min favoritkonsol, linjelasern.
Du kan också se marknadsföringsmaillistan som ett resultat av tty-konsoler genom att läsa / sys / flair / tty / console / active
. Systemdokumentationen anger att den första basavvärjningen som visas är huvudkonsolen. Listan kan beskrivas som i omvänd ordning från kärnans kommandorader. I den aktuella dokumentationen, poisonDet föreslås felaktigt att den sista enheten som visas är en extremt “aktiv” huvudkonsol. Av någon anledning har det också blivit möjligt att fråga den här filen för att fånga ändringar (om konsolverktygen togs bort?).
Behållaren systemd-nspawn
ersätter den allmänna databasen / dev / console
som har en pseudoterminalenhet (PTY). De bestäms bäst som virtuella terminaler. De är specifikt designade – var dynamiska och används också för att märka grafiska terminalemulatorer, såsom GNOME-kritiska, i aktion, kombinerat med fjärråtkomst, till exempel på grund av faktumet ssh
.
/ Dev för varje Tty0
Linux TTY-enhetsnoder tty1
till tty63
är inbäddade final. De kallas även VT eller virtuella system. Du modellerar flera konsoler i termer av en fysisk konsolenhetsdrivrutin. Endast en internetkonsol visas och förfinas i taget. Den aktiva dödliga signalen kan växlas, till exempel med chvt
, Ctrl + Alt + F1, eller antalet funktionsidéer som är tillgängliga för klienter.
Du kan möjligen läsa och skriva för att kontrollera aktuell VT med / dev / tty0
. tty0
kommer förmodligen att vara en konventionell kärnkonsol, till exempel, du valde den inte uttryckligen inuti. Systemet “söker först efter VGA-enhetskortet [med VT] och sedan den serialiserade porten.” Du kan också direkt konfigurera konsolen för att hjälpa dig en specifik E vt, t.ex. konsol är lika med tty1
.
“Om din programvara hellre än har ett vga-kort, kommer de första seriella insticksmodulerna automatiskt att bli konsolen.” Ett “sekventiellt spelsystem på internet” som ttyS0
är säkert den vanligaste
code> tty0 . Det är inte avsett att användas av ett annat VT-system på en seriell konsol.
– Dev / Tty
dev / tty
är en av de tre standardenhetsfilerna som anges i POSIX ( per dev /
är en av de sista men inte minst katalogerna namn som anges i POSIX). Öppning motsvarar – öppning av terminal för övervakning av det aktuella steget. När utvecklingen stoppas kan kontrollterminalen öppna terminalen först, åtminstone via Linux. Till exempel, i init
, bör huset verkligen referera till / dev / controller eller console
.
Inaktivera Körkontrollen från någon terminal är ett av stegen som vanligtvis är viktiga för att starta en bakgrundsprocess, som att öppna syslog-demonen. Stegen som blir en helt ny bakgrundsprocess skulle vara fruktansvärt komplex, men personligt eget steg som inte involverar att kontrollera dessa flygplatser är setsid-systemanropet. På en hel del modernare system, startar ett startsystem som systemd en tjänst utan en hanteringsport.
Vad betyder LCK..ttyusbx för serieporten?
Historiens moral: Om du försöker ansluta ett utvecklingskort (eller något där det kan komma åt en senare port) till ditt program, kommer det automatiskt att generera en fil med namnet LCK..ttyUSBx (x – 0..9) Worry / var / fastening /, som innehåller motsvarande process-ID som följer med processen som startades med porten.
How Do You Deal With Dev / Tty Debugging Is Locked
Come Gestisci Dev / Tty Il Debug è Bloccato?
Hoe Ga Je Om Met Dev / Tty Debugging Is Vergrendeld
Как вы справляетесь с Dev / Tty Отладка заблокирована
Como Você Lida Com Dev / Tty A Depuração Está Bloqueada
Dev / Tty 디버깅을 어떻게 처리합니까?
Wie Gehen Sie Mit Dev / Tty Um Debugging Ist Gesperrt
Jak Radzisz Sobie Z Dev / Tty Debugowanie Jest Zablokowane
¿Cómo Se Maneja Con Dev / Tty? La Depuración Está Bloqueada
Comment Gérez-vous Le Dev/tty Le Débogage Est Verrouillé